The thematic area of the project
"Resilient Data Transfer Method and Prototype for Reducing Cyber Risk in Critical Systems (ReDAT)".
Description of the thematic area
The ReDAT project aims to develop a resilient data transfer and control methodology and a prototype solution to reduce cyber risk for critical information systems and critical infrastructure. The research will design and test resilient transmission schemes (e.g., FEC/rateless), model network degradation scenarios, and analyse SIEM logs and threat indicators, leveraging HPC and cloud technologies. The results will contribute to improved cyber resilience and safer management of data flows.
